Sacramento's Largest Personal Injury Settlement Awarded

An Oregon girl that was accidentally run over by a truck driven by her father was awarded a $24.3 million personal injury settlement following a trial involving a semi-truck accident that happened in 2004.

Diana Yuleidy Loza-Jimenez was given the settlement by a Superior Court jury on March 5, 2010 from Freeway Transport, Inc., the Portland, Oregon trucking company a judge found responsible.  According to the Sacramento bar association, this personal injury settlement is the largest in Sacramento County history.

Six years ago, Loza-Jimenez, who is now 14, joined her family on a Thanksgiving long-haul trip from their house in Hermiston, Oregon to Bakersfield, California where they were going to visit relatives and pick up a load to bring back to Oregon.  While traveling, they stopped near Mount Shasta, and the driver of the truck, Simon Loza Mejia, got back in the truck and pulled out with his daughter still outside.  Loza-Jimenez was pulled underneath the truck’s rear wheels, which caused her injuries.

The Freeway Transport defense team argued that because wasn’t the actual long-haul carrier, they shouldn’t be held responsible.  The company brokered Loza Mejia’s truck deal to haul the shipment.
